Transaction 121f2e8407044d3c0367eecb4757a8f1da23927ff3393490ac58fefe4d1ff086
3 Input
2 Outputs
- 121f2e8407044d3c0367eecb4757a8f1da23927ff3393490ac58fefe4d1ff086:0
- 121f2e8407044d3c0367eecb4757a8f1da23927ff3393490ac58fefe4d1ff086:1
value 2340185
address 1PpUBser9yLGeN3zscTcUSyZfimuTKz9U7
value 5057900
address 3PHt2PCjetCXZ55pdey6JTqNrmFoDNr6eV